Answer:

  7 square feet per student

Step-by-step explanation:

To find "A per B", divide the quantity of A by the quantity of B. It can help to keep the units with the numbers.

Here, you want area per student, so divide area by students:

  area per student = (357 ft²)/(51 students) = 7 ft²/student

The relationship is 7 square feet per student.
